Watch the Dubai Fountain

The Dubai Fountain, the world’s largest fountain, is a spectacle that you cannot miss. The light and sound show, along with the dancing fountain, lights up every tourist’s mood in Downtown. Anyone who visits the Dubai Fountain always returns feeling mesmerised. 

Location: Downtown Dubai

Timings: Afternoon: 1:00 to 1:30; Evening: Every 30 minutes from 6:00 PM to 11:00 PM

Visit Alserkal Avenue

The art centre of Dubai is a haven for art lovers and aesthetic enthusiasts. Stroll between the art galleries, check out the museums, and numerous workshops. Not only this, but this district has stunning outdoor attractions too, which are indeed perfect for photographs. 

Location: Al Quoz Industrial Area

Things to do: Visit galleries, cafes, cinema, workshops and museums

Light Show at Al Wasl Plaza

Al Wasl Plaza showcases a 360 degree light show every day for free. It’s one of the most sensational shows that not many people know about. Furthermore, you can find 252 drones projecting along with an immersive sound system. 

Location: Expo City Dubai

Timings: 00:00 – 23:59 daily

Camping at Al Qudra Lakes

Camp with your friends and family at Al Qudra Lakes. There is no entry fee, but you should not litter in the desert. The area has amenities like a BBQ grill, shaded seating and clean restrooms. Not only this, you can enjoy stargazing, bird watching and cycling also here, making it a perfect place for a night stay or evening hangout. 

Location: Al Marmoom Desert Conservation Reserve
